本质:让一个元素在页面中隐藏或显示出来.
1.display属性
display属性用于设置一个元素应如何显示....属性值 描述
visible 不剪切内容也不添加滚动条
hidden 不显示超过对象尺寸的内容,超出的部分隐藏掉
scroll 不管超出内容与否,总是显示滚动条
auto 超出自动显示滚动条,不超出不显示滚动条...一般情况下,我们都不想让溢出的内容显示出来,因为溢出的部分会影响布局....下面做一个土豆网的案例
当鼠标经过时,显示遮罩层和播放图标
这时就要用到我们的隐藏和显示知识了,遮罩层应该是整个盒子的一个子元素,不占有位置,因此要使用绝对定位,而元素的隐藏使用的是display.../images/arr.png) no-repeat center;
}
/* 这里是让鼠标经过.tudou这个盒子时让mask遮罩层显示出来 而不是.mask:hover